Output 8e68b8b2d25c9da90d442c8162d20ad00fe32b4d1a9faa9840cb6a1e9038647a:1

value
3141658202
script pubkey
OP_0 OP_PUSHBYTES_20 5ba4079fcc56b28c6e2760841d6c5106ac798811
address
tb1qtwjq087v26egcm38vzzp6mz3q6k8nzq3v5gy0u
transaction
8e68b8b2d25c9da90d442c8162d20ad00fe32b4d1a9faa9840cb6a1e9038647a
confirmations
111083
spent
true